Glamour mare Enable missed out on her third straight Arc last year but she had little trouble notching  her third win in the Group I King George VI and Queen Elizabeth Stakes.
Enable faced only two rivals in the Ascot event but disposed of the Aidan O’Brien-trained pair Sovereign and Japan to score by 5½ lengths. Enable also won the race in 2017 and 2019.
